    Gen 1 OP Checklist:
    1) Are you a Psychic or Normal type?
    2) Can you abuse the fact that Sp. Atk and Sp. Def aren't split up?
    3) Can you abuse the Spd = Crit chance mechanic?
    4) Can you abuse Hyper beam or any status conditions?
    5) Can you learn Amnesia?

    one important thing about Hyperbeam, if you one shotted a pokemon, it had no cool down. Victreebell or Venusaur should have made it in over Rhydon. The only reason they wouldn't be overpowered is because of Mewtwo and Alakazam. Sleep Powder, wrap, leech seed and always critical razor leafs. Sleep status was broken in this game because waking up took a whole move, and if you were wrapped, it wouldn't even give you a chance to wake up. . Dugtrio was a great pokemon,. Having high speed made moves more accurate, which made fissures a pretty reliable move, as well as very fast Earthquakes and critical hit slashes. Nidoking was great too, very strong and versatile

    I'd personally like to add Sandslash as an honorable mention. Primarily for the same reason as Persian; once it learns Slash, it's quite brutal, despite having lower base speed. It is certainly very weak to some elemental types, considering it's low special, but it is probably my favorite brawler in GEN 1. I almost always run one on my team. With Sandshrew evolving at level 22, it's quite easy to get this pokemon early game. For how much base attack and defense it has, it still has pretty good HP and speed. Not only is Slash great, but Dig, Rock Throw, and Earthquake can all have devastating effect, with the added bonus of Dig being a useful utility outside of battle. It has great match-ups against electric, rock, and poison pokemon. These types often were capable of doing lots of burst damage or applying crippling status effects. As a result, while certain elemental or normal types may have been able to do more damage to the target, or take the first move due to greater speed, they could end up receiving a lot of punishment and not having the stamina left to take out a powerful pokemon they were a specific counter to later in the fight. Sandslash is a great pokemon to keep on your team as a general tank with few weaknesses, which also has to ability to 1 hit many of the weaker pokemon. This allows you to save your more offense based, low defense/HP pokemon for later in the fight , and have them be clear of status effects, when the opponent brings out their specialized bruisers. I found Sandslash to be of great utility during both Victory Road and The Final Four, as he could take the hits for my more fragile pokemon, and still dish out a decent bit of damage on his own.

      Exeggutor is fairly bulky with a very high special stat and resistances to Ground and Psychic moves which constituted a large portion of the meta. It could wall opposing pokemon like Golem, Rhydon, Alakazm, Exeggutor, Snorlax, etc.
      Exeggutor was also a very solid status inflictor thanks to Sleep Powder, making it a good lead. With a 125 special stat for stab Psychic as well as the ability to use Explosion, Exeggutor was also pretty potent offensively.
      Meanwhile, Victreebel is just an overrated sweeper that is too slow to be of an use by itself. It has good attacking stats and access to Sleep Powder, but its slow and weak to Psychic, making it only very useful against Paralyzed pokemon. Something like Tauros is generally better as a late game sweeper.

    One thing that you skip over in regards to Jolteon is the fact that it naturally learns Pin Missile, a Bug-type move, that is super effective against Psychic. And with its naturally high speed you can often get the upper hand against some of the highest tier Psychic-type Pokemon. I never met an Alakazam that I couldn't take with Jolteon.
